Login and PW Being Rejected Post Update
This is a new one. I cleared out my cache, cookies, and history in Firefox for the first time in a long time a few days after updating my version of Textpattern to the most recent version. It has, since, begun refusing my login and password which i know to be 100% accurate. I have even gone so far as to doublecheck their accuracy by viewing the hardcoded config file. I am now unable to log into (as I am the only publisher) my own website. I can’t create a new account, or modify the old one – I am at a complete loss of what to do short of completely reinstall TP which I refuse to do. I’ve doublechecked everything from the database connection to the config file and everything appears fine. But whenever I attempt to login I get the ‘Invalid login/password’ response – what am I to do??

Re: Login and PW Being Rejected Post Update
The only constellation where this could happen, is if you installed textpattern with mysql4.1 or newer, and then downgraded mysql to 4.0 or older. (Because textpattern relies on a built-in function of mysql that changed between 4.0 and 4.1). Anyway there is a solution documented in Textbook:

Re: Login and PW Being Rejected Post Update
I have even gone so far as to doublecheck their accuracy by viewing the hardcoded config file.
The MySQL login in the config file is not the same as the Textpattern user login.

Re: Login and PW Being Rejected Post Update
Check the link Sencer posted. You’ll have to actually reset the password, because passwords are not stored in plain text, but hashed, which is irreversible.
